About The Property - Located off the the Twyncyn, Marchglade offers substantial accommodation over 4000 sq. ft , yet is a short walk to all the village. Dinas Powys offers a variety of shops, public houses, restaurants and coffee shops as well as leisure facilities including a tennis, golf and bowling club. The village has excellent transport links with two train stations and a short drive to Cardiff City Centre and the M4 Motorway.
A dramatic double height central entrance hall with a galleried landing offers woodblock parquet flooring, an exposed brickwork wall, a double sided feature fireplace, exposed wooden beams, a wall mounted alarm panel and a carpeted wooden staircase with an under stairs storage cupboard leading to the first floor.
Double doors lead to a versatile heated conservatory with tiled floor and uPVC double glazed windows to all elevations with a door providing access to the rear garden.
An arched opening from the hallway leads to the bay-fronted living room which enjoys elevated views over Dinas Powys, a beamed ceiling and carpeted flooring. A door to the rear of the living room leads to the generously proportioned, versatile family room.
The second bay-fronted sitting room is located next to the kitchen and offers a wonderful southerly aspect and elevated views across Dinas Powys.
The modern kitchen & breakfast room has been fitted with a range of base and wall units, granite work tops, granite splash backs, an under-mount sink unit and a central island. Appliances to remain include: an electric oven/grill, a 4-ring induction hob with an extractor fan over and a dishwasher. Space and plumbing has been provided for freestanding white goods.
From the kitchen there is access into a utility room which leads out to the rear garden, a 2-piece cloakroom and access into the double integral garage.
To the first floor, an impressive gallery landing leads to 5 spacious bedrooms. Bedrooms one and two both benefits from an en-suite and walk in wardrobe. Bedrooms three and four both offer fitted wardrobes and additional eaves storage while bedroom five is currently being used as a home office.
The large family bathroom is fitted with a corner spa bath, a shower cubicle with a thermostatic shower over, a pedestal wash-hand basin, a WC and a bidet. The bathroom further benefits from tiled walls and a large airing cupboard.
Gardens & Grounds -
Marchglade occupies an enviable plot and is situated at the end of a quiet cul-de-sac of Kings Ride which is one of just seven properties. A block paved driveway providing ample off-road parking for several vehicles leading to an integral double garage with an electrically operated door.
The front garden offers a southerly aspect and far reaching views and enjoys a lawned area with a variety of mature shrubbery.
The landscaped rear garden is arranged over two tiers. The lower offers a block paved terrace providing ample space for outdoor entertaining and dining whereas the upper lawned area with further sun terrace enjoys a variety of mature trees/shrubbery which offers privacy and screening.
The detached workshop has cavity blockwork walls lying beneath a flat roof. The rooms offers huge potential as a workshop, studio or home office. Power points and lighting.
Additional Information - All mains services connected.
Freehold.
Council tax band 'I'.
